Output 2a8627bb6ba24c3c74d56ad60b705b9a68f5a2f4dc7dc9878ee58e47cfe3f199:10

value
325106275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e9fe66268cad3161a89ddcef1ea5867139c160 OP_EQUAL
address
3BM3BrdNxFXk7f1847y6H45jZGcRiwNsdf
transaction
2a8627bb6ba24c3c74d56ad60b705b9a68f5a2f4dc7dc9878ee58e47cfe3f199
spent
true